The lighting in the streets is an important part of modern cities. A planned lighting system not only lights up the roads, but it also contributes to safety, efficiency, and general living conditions in the urban areas.
The visibility of street lights to drivers, cyclists, and pedestrians is good, especially when it is dark and during rainy seasons. Adequate lighting minimizes accidents because road users can recognize the road signs, lights, and road lines in time.
Light streets deter crimes and provide people with a safer place to live. Lighting is sufficient to enhance visibility in the open areas, enhance the surveillance systems, which lead to improved law enforcement and community safety.
Street lighting is very reliable and provides smooth movement in traffic and the flow of people. It aids the population to get around streets, intersections and crossings comfortably in dark hours, which favors 24-hour urban life.
The new generation of street lighting systems is developed to use a reduced amount of power and produce quality lighting. Energy-saving systems assist municipalities in saving money on electricity, as well as maximizing operating budgets.
The use of efficient street lights also helps to minimize carbon emissions through the energy reduction. Wastes and the environmental costs of replacing lighting systems frequently are also reduced by long-lasting lighting systems.
City lights make cities look more beautiful because roads, landscapes and buildings are emphasized. Light-filled streets provide a friendly and systematic urban environment.
Cities wishing to minimize carbon footprints have energy optimization as one of their priorities. LED Street Light systems also use a lot less electricity but give a better light. Such efficiency is in the form of decreased load on power grids and the costs of operations.
Intelligent dimming options also improve efficiency by varying the brightness according to the amount of traffic, time of the day, or even the weather. This smart energy is an energy management system that promotes sustainable urban development.

| Feature | Description | Smart City Benefit |
| Energy Efficiency | Consumes significantly less power compared to conventional lighting | Reduces electricity costs and load on city grids |
| Long Lifespan | Designed for extended operational life with minimal degradation | Lowers replacement and maintenance frequency |
| Uniform Illumination | Provides balanced light distribution with reduced glare | Enhances road safety and visibility |
| Smart Control Compatibility | Supports dimming, automation, and remote monitoring | Enables intelligent energy management |
| Low Maintenance | Fewer component failures due to robust design | Minimizes operational downtime |
| Environmental Friendly | Low carbon emissions and no harmful substances | Supports sustainable urban development |
| Weather Resistant Design | Built to withstand heat, rain, dust, and harsh climates | Ensures reliable outdoor performance |
| Improved Public Safety | Better visibility for pedestrians and vehicles | Reduces accidents and crime rates |
| Cost Effectiveness | Saves energy and maintenance expenses over time | Offers long-term financial benefits |
| Smart City Ready | Easily integrates with IoT and smart infrastructure | Future-proof urban lighting solution |
